JOB SUMMARY:
The Guest Experience Ticket Booth Representative serves as a key front-line ambassador for the Dallas Arboretum & Botanical Garden. This role is responsible for delivering exceptional customer service by assisting guests in person and over the phone, supporting ticket sales, and ensuring a welcoming, informative, and seamless entry experience. The ideal candidate is professional, friendly, and committed to upholding Arboretum standards and policies while creating memorable guest interactions.
This is a Seasonal position that requires the availability to work a flexible schedule, including weekends, holidays, and/or seasonal evening events.
